[mlir] NFC - Move runner utils from mlir-cpu-runner to ExecutionEngine
authorNicolas Vasilache <ntv@google.com>
Thu, 27 Feb 2020 14:51:15 +0000 (09:51 -0500)
committerNicolas Vasilache <ntv@google.com>
Thu, 27 Feb 2020 15:02:24 +0000 (10:02 -0500)
commitfcfd3a281c1d6ffd40e4acc430eba448fa6c8423
tree5fec69c596c4db724e4b4aa5c2971cf84b39165e
parent4569b3a86f8a4b1b8ad28fe2321f936f9d7ffd43
[mlir] NFC - Move runner utils from mlir-cpu-runner to ExecutionEngine

Runner utils are useful beyond just CPU and hiding them within the test directory
makes it unnecessarily harder to reuse in other projects.
mlir/include/mlir/ExecutionEngine/RunnerUtils.h [moved from mlir/test/mlir-cpu-runner/include/mlir_runner_utils.h with 98% similarity]
mlir/lib/ExecutionEngine/CMakeLists.txt
mlir/lib/ExecutionEngine/RunnerUtils.cpp [moved from mlir/test/mlir-cpu-runner/mlir_runner_utils.cpp with 96% similarity]
mlir/test/CMakeLists.txt
mlir/test/mlir-cpu-runner/CMakeLists.txt
mlir/test/mlir-cpu-runner/include/cblas.h
mlir/test/mlir-cpu-runner/include/cblas_interface.h